Key takeaway

The company, ScoutDI, offers a tethered drone inspection system that ensures unlimited flight time and a robust data link for live streaming inspection data. Their Scout Portal enhances the inspection process with cloud-based tools for data management, storage, and analysis, making it ideal for stress-free and comprehensive inspections.

Information about Drone Inspection in Norway

The Drone Inspection industry in Norway is shaped by several critical considerations that potential entrants should keep in mind. Firstly, regulatory compliance is paramount; Norway has strict aviation regulations governed by the Civil Aviation Authority, which mandates proper certifications for drone operators and adherence to safety standards. Understanding these regulations is essential for legal operation and gaining trust from clients. Additionally, the challenging Norwegian terrain and variable weather conditions can impact inspection capabilities, requiring operators to invest in robust technology and training. Opportunities abound in sectors such as oil and gas, infrastructure, and environmental monitoring, where drones can significantly enhance efficiency and reduce human risk. However, companies must also address environmental concerns, particularly regarding wildlife disturbances and noise pollution, to maintain public support and regulatory compliance. The competitive landscape is evolving, with both local and international players entering the market, so differentiation through technology, service quality, and customer relations is crucial. Furthermore, as the global market for drone inspections grows, Norway's strategic position and emphasis on innovation present a unique opportunity for businesses to establish themselves as leaders in this field. Understanding these factors will be key for anyone researching or entering the drone inspection industry in Norway.
